The sum of three consecutive multiples of three is 90.Find the number​

Answer:

27,30,33

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the first number be x.

The next number is x+3.

The next number is x+6.

x+(x+3)+(x+6)=90

x+x+3+x+6=90

combine terms

3x+9=90

Subtract 9 from both sides of the equation.

3x=81

Divide both sides of the equation by 3

x=27, x+3=30, x+6=33

Check 27+30+33=90
